Overview

After the death of his mother, the evil mutant wizard Blackwolf discovers some long-lost military technologies. Full of ego and ambition, Blackwolf claims his mother’s throne, assembles an army and sets out to brainwash and conquer Earth. Meanwhile, Blackwolf’s gentle twin brother, the bearded and sage Avatar, calls upon his own magical abilities to foil Blackwolf’s plans for world domination—even if it means destroying his own flesh and blood.
